annotate RefPrj/FontPack/.project @ 196:2885628ab3ba div-fixes-cleaup-2

Bugfix, minor: color the overview customview correctly When using a custom color (from the SYS2 menu, layout), the overview customview was the only one presented in the wrong color. While the fix for this is rather simple (in hindsight), it was a non trivial search trough rather obfuscated code. There is a specific function to set the text color index on this page, but this only worked for a single line text string, that has the color index byte as the very first character. The original author already recognized that this function "could be extended", but left this extension as an exercise to the reader. So, the coloring is fixed by extending the function, and actually using it for the overview customview. Signed-off-by: Jan Mulder <jlmulder@xs4all.nl>
author Jan Mulder <jlmulder@xs4all.nl>
date Wed, 20 Mar 2019 16:24:10 +0100
parents b33c7f2ae0d9
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
79
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
1 <?xml version="1.0" encoding="UTF-8"?>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
2 <projectDescription>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
3 <name>OSTC4_FontPack</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
4 <comment></comment>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
5 <projects>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
6 </projects>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
7 <buildSpec>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
8 <buildCommand>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
9 <name>org.eclipse.cdt.managedbuilder.core.genmakebuilder</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
10 <triggers>clean,full,incremental,</triggers>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
11 <arguments>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
12 </arguments>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
13 </buildCommand>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
14 <buildCommand>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
15 <name>org.eclipse.cdt.managedbuilder.core.ScannerConfigBuilder</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
16 <triggers>full,incremental,</triggers>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
17 <arguments>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
18 </arguments>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
19 </buildCommand>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
20 </buildSpec>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
21 <natures>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
22 <nature>org.eclipse.cdt.core.cnature</nature>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
23 <nature>org.eclipse.cdt.managedbuilder.core.managedBuildNature</nature>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
24 <nature>org.eclipse.cdt.managedbuilder.core.ScannerConfigNature</nature>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
25 <nature>fr.ac6.mcu.ide.core.MCUProjectNature</nature>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
26 <nature>fr.ac6.mcu.ide.core.MCUSingleCoreProjectNature</nature>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
27 </natures>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
28 <linkedResources>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
29 <link>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
30 <name>Common</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
31 <type>2</type>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
32 <locationURI>OSTC4/Common</locationURI>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
33 </link>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
34 <link>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
35 <name>Discovery</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
36 <type>2</type>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
37 <locationURI>OSTC4/Discovery</locationURI>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
38 </link>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
39 <link>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
40 <name>src/base_upperRegion.c</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
41 <type>1</type>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
42 <locationURI>OSTC4/FontPack/base_upperRegion.c</locationURI>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
43 </link>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
44 </linkedResources>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
45 <variableList>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
46 <variable>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
47 <name>OSTC4</name>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
48 <value>$%7BWORKSPACE_LOC%7D/ostc4</value>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
49 </variable>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
50 </variableList>
b33c7f2ae0d9 Added Fontpack reference project
Ideenmodellierer
parents:
diff changeset
51 </projectDescription>